Effective Communication in Coaching: Building Trust and Rapport
Effective communication is the bedrock of successful coaching. For the purpose of foster a strong coach-client relationship, it's crucial to cultivate an environment built on trust and rapport. Clients are more inclined coaching to open up and be honest when they feel comfortable sharing their thoughts and feelings. Active listening, empathy, and clear communication are fundamental elements in achieving this bond.
- Practice active listening by providing your full attention to the client's copyright and nonverbal cues.
- Convey empathy by trying to understand the client's standpoint.
- Provide clear and constructive feedback that is both specific and supportive.
